What Are Cashback Websites and How Do They Work?
The Basic Concept
Cashback websites act as intermediaries between you, the shopper, and the retailers you love. When you make a purchase through a cashback website, a portion of the money the retailer would have spent on advertising is shared with you. It’s a win-win situation: retailers get more customers, and you get money back.
- Think of it as a referral bonus: the cashback site refers you to the retailer, and in return, they receive a commission, a piece of which is passed on to you.

How Cashback Websites Earn Money
Cashback websites operate on affiliate marketing principles. They earn commissions from retailers for every successful referral that leads to a purchase. These commissions vary based on the retailer and the product category. The cashback website then shares a percentage of this commission with the shopper in the form of cashback.
- Example: A retailer might offer a 10% commission to the cashback website for every sale made through their referral link. If you spend $100 at that retailer through the cashback site, the site receives $10. They might then give you $5 back (5% cashback), keeping the remaining $5 for themselves.
Benefits of Using Cashback Websites
Save Money on Everyday Purchases
Cashback can significantly reduce the cost of your everyday purchases, from groceries and clothing to electronics and travel. Over time, these savings can add up to a substantial amount.
- Imagine earning 3% cashback on all your grocery purchases. If you spend $100 per week on groceries, that’s $3 back per week, or $156 per year!
Combine with Other Savings Methods
Cashback can be combined with other money-saving strategies, such as using coupons, promotional codes, and credit card rewards. This allows you to “stack” savings and maximize your discounts.
- Example: Use a coupon code for 20% off at a clothing store, pay with a credit card that offers points or cashback, and also go through a cashback website to earn an additional percentage back.
A Wide Range of Retailers
Cashback websites partner with a vast array of retailers, spanning various industries. This means you can earn cashback on almost anything you buy online.
- From major department stores and online marketplaces to smaller, niche retailers, the options are virtually endless.
Passive Income
Earning cashback is essentially a passive income stream. Once you get into the habit of shopping through cashback websites, you can automatically earn money back on your purchases without any extra effort.
Choosing the Right Cashback Website
Factors to Consider
When selecting a cashback website, consider the following factors:
- Cashback Rates: Compare the cashback rates offered by different websites for the retailers you frequent.
- Retailer Selection: Ensure the website partners with a wide variety of retailers that you shop with regularly.
- Payout Methods: Check the available payout methods (e.g., PayPal, check, gift cards) and choose one that suits your preferences.
- Minimum Payout Threshold: Be aware of the minimum amount you need to earn before you can request a payout.
- User Reviews and Reputation: Read reviews and check the website’s reputation to ensure it is reliable and trustworthy.
Popular Cashback Platforms
Here are some popular cashback websites:
- Rakuten (formerly Ebates): Known for its high cashback rates and frequent promotions.
- Honey: Offers a browser extension that automatically finds and applies coupons and cashback offers while you shop.
- Swagbucks: Provides multiple ways to earn points, including shopping, taking surveys, and watching videos.
- TopCashback: Offers some of the highest cashback rates, but may have fewer retailers than other platforms.
- Capital One Shopping (formerly Wikibuy): Compares prices across multiple retailers and automatically applies available coupons.
Comparing Cashback Rates
Cashback rates can vary significantly between websites and retailers. It’s crucial to compare rates before making a purchase to ensure you’re getting the best deal.
- Use a cashback comparison tool or manually check the rates offered by different websites for the same retailer. For example, Rakuten might offer 5% cashback at a particular store, while TopCashback offers 7%.
Maximizing Your Cashback Earnings
Shop Strategically
Plan your purchases and check cashback rates before you shop. Look for opportunities to combine cashback with other discounts and promotions.
- Before buying anything online, always check to see if it’s available through a cashback website. Make it a habit!
Utilize Browser Extensions
Install browser extensions that automatically find and apply cashback offers while you shop. These extensions can save you time and ensure you never miss out on a cashback opportunity.
- Honey and Capital One Shopping are excellent browser extensions that can streamline the cashback process.
Take Advantage of Promotions
Cashback websites often run special promotions and bonus offers. Keep an eye out for these opportunities to boost your earnings.
- Many platforms offer increased cashback rates during holidays or special events.
Referral Programs
Refer friends and family to your favorite cashback website and earn a bonus when they sign up and make a purchase.
- Sharing your referral link is a great way to earn extra cashback without spending any money.
Potential Drawbacks and Considerations
Tracking Issues
Sometimes, purchases may not be tracked correctly, resulting in missing cashback. This can happen due to browser settings, ad blockers, or issues with the retailer’s tracking system.
- If you experience tracking issues, contact the cashback website’s customer support and provide them with the necessary purchase information. Always take screenshots of your order confirmation.
Minimum Payout Thresholds
Most cashback websites have a minimum payout threshold that you need to reach before you can withdraw your earnings. This can be frustrating if you only make occasional purchases.
- Consider choosing a website with a low minimum payout threshold if you don’t shop online frequently.
Time to Receive Cashback
It can take several weeks or even months for cashback to be credited to your account. This is because the retailer needs to confirm the purchase and pay the commission to the cashback website.
- Be patient and keep track of your purchases to ensure you receive your cashback in a timely manner.
